Tilleke & Gibbins Earns Top Rankings in Benchmark Litigation Asia-Pacific 2025

Benchmark Litigation has released its 2025 rankings for leading dispute resolution firms in the Asia-Pacific region, highlighting Tilleke & Gibbins’ continued success in the region. The Benchmark Litigation rankings include two jurisdictions where Tilleke & Gibbins is active, Thailand and Vietnam.

Firm Rankings

A full summary of the firm’s rankings is provided below:

Thailand

  • Commercial & Transactions – Tier 1
  • Government & Regulatory – Tier 1
  • Labor & Employment – Tier 1
  • Intellectual Property – Tier 1
  • Trade & Customs – Tier 2

Vietnam

  • Commercial & Transactions (Foreign Firms) – Tier 1
  • Intellectual Property (Foreign Firms) – Tier 1
  • Labor & Employment (Foreign Firms) – Recommended (top tier in this category)
  • Energy & Construction (Foreign Firms) – Tier 2
  • International Arbitration – Highly Recommended

Individual Rankings

The 2025 edition also recognizes a record 10 Tilleke & Gibbins lawyers in Thailand—more than any other firm in the jurisdiction—and four in Vietnam.

Benchmark Litigation’s annual research is based on interviews with dispute resolution specialists and clients, as well as analysis of recent casework and market developments.
